如何将安卓的log开到I级
时间: 2023-08-18 19:08:50 浏览: 126
要将安卓的log开到I级,可以通过以下步骤实现:
1. 在Android Studio中打开你的项目。
2. 打开Android Device Monitor。
3. 选择你的设备并进入“Logcat”标签页。
4. 在过滤器中输入“*:I”。
5. 点击“过滤”按钮。
6. 现在你将只看到I级别及以上的日志。
另外,你还可以在代码中使用以下语句将特定标签的日志级别设置为I级:
```java
Log.i(TAG, "这是一条I级别的日志");
```
其中,TAG是你指定的标签名称,可根据需要设置。
相关问题
Android log 和toast
Android Log是Android开发中一个非常重要的调试工具,可以在控制台输出各种信息,例如日志信息、异常信息等等,便于开发者进行调试和排查问题。可以使用以下方法输出Log信息:
1. Log.v():输出 verbose 级别的日志信息
2. Log.d():输出 debug 级别的日志信息
3. Log.i():输出 info 级别的日志信息
4. Log.w():输出 warn 级别的日志信息
5. Log.e():输出 error 级别的日志信息
Toast是Android中一个轻量级的提示工具,可以在屏幕上弹出一段短暂的提示信息,例如操作成功或失败的提示信息。可以使用以下方法创建和显示Toast:
```java
Toast.makeText(context, message, duration).show();
```
其中,context为上下文对象,message为提示信息,duration为提示信息显示的时间长短,可以是Toast.LENGTH_SHORT(短时间)或Toast.LENGTH_LONG(长时间)。调用show()方法将Toast显示在屏幕上。
Logcat怎么设置只输出LOG.i
在Android Studio中,想要在Logcat中只显示`LOG.i`级别的日志,你可以按照以下步骤操作:
1. 打开Logcat:点击工具栏上的`Window`菜单,选择`Show Logcat`或者使用快捷键`Ctrl+Alt+L`(Windows/Linux)或`Cmd+,'`(Mac)。
2. 设置过滤器:在Logcat面板的顶部,你会看到一个文本框。在其中输入`.i`(注意首字母大写),然后点击旁边的下拉箭头,选择`Filter by log level`。
3. 选择日志级别:现在从下拉列表中选择`Info (I)`,这将仅显示`INFO`级别及其以上的日志,包括`DEBUG`、`WARN`和`ERROR`等,而不会显示`VERBOSE`和`ASSERT`级别的信息。
4. 确认设置:点击确定或者应用更改,Logcat就会只显示你设置的`LOG.i`级别的日志了。
如果你只想永久地改变默认设置,可以在项目级的`build.gradle`文件中添加以下配置:
```gradle
android {
defaultConfig {
// ...
loggingOptions {
verbose = false
debug = true
info = true
warn = true
error = true
assert = false
}
}
}
```
这样每次新建工程或者启动应用时,Logcat都会按照这个配置来显示日志。
阅读全文